		<description>[...] In that final session, Jancis Robinson said, in answer to a question about the future influence of blogs: &#8220;&#8230; (there is a) huge generation of people &#8230; who are dying to communicate about wine and are very frustrated that dinosaurs like me, and my colleagues who write columns in the National Press, in Britain anyway, refuse to move out of our &#8217;slots&#8217; and make room for them, so this is a natural place for a new wave of wine enthusiasm to communicate itself.&#8221; &#8211; Jancis Robinson, Wine Future 2009 (see mins 3:09 &#8211; 3:38 on the Vinus.tv video) [...]</description>
